Marilyn K. Szekendi is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Emergency Medical Services. According to data from OpenAlex, Marilyn K. Szekendi has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 509 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in General Health Professions, 6 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 5 papers in Emergency Medical Services. Recurrent topics in Marilyn K. Szekendi’s work include Medical Malpractice and Liability Issues (5 papers),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(4 papers) and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(4 papers). Marilyn K. Szekendi is often cited by papers focused on Medical Malpractice and Liability Issues (5 papers),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(4 papers) and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(4 papers). Marilyn K. Szekendi collaborates with scholars based in United States. Marilyn K. Szekendi's co-authors include Mark V. Williams, Stephen H. Thomas, Kevin J. OʼLeary, Gary A. Noskin, Cynthia Barnard, Julie Cerese, Victoria M. Steelman, Kei Ouchi, Phillip Chang and Danielle Julie Carrier and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American College of Surgeons, Journal of Pain and Symptom Management and Archives of Pathology & Laboratory Medicine.
